December 30th: Kicking Off the Action

The bowl season officially gets underway on December 30th ⁢with​ a pair of exciting⁣ contests.

* JLab Birmingham Bowl: Memphis​ and James Madison are potential contenders, offering ‌a clash of styles. Alternatively, a matchup between Clemson ​and UTSA could deliver a high-powered offensive showcase.
* Radiance Technologies Independence Bowl: Kansas faces Kennesaw State in one projection, while Baylor and Western Kentucky represent another ‌possibility. Expect a hard-fought battle in Shreveport, Louisiana.

December 31st: New Year’s Eve Showdowns

New⁤ Year’s Eve brings a heavier dose of bowl action, culminating in some‍ prime-time matchups. ‍

* Music City Bowl: ⁢Nebraska versus Missouri⁤ is a compelling Big Ten/SEC showdown. However, Minnesota and LSU could also ‍deliver a similarly intense contest.
* Valero Alamo ⁤Bowl: Cincinnati and USC are frequently mentioned⁢ as potential participants, promising a West ⁣Coast flavour. This game consistently draws ‍a large ‍audience.
* ‍ reliaquest Bowl: illinois and Texas are a strong possibility, offering a Big 12/Big Ten battle. Iowa versus Tennessee is another intriguing scenario, potentially featuring contrasting offensive approaches.
* ‌ Tony the ‍Tiger Sun Bowl: ⁢ Wake Forest and Arizona ⁢State could provide an exciting ​matchup. Miami and⁢ California are also in‌ the mix, offering a Pac-12/ACC ⁢clash.
* Cheez-It Citrus Bowl: Michigan is widely projected to appear, potentially against​ Vanderbilt. A⁢ more notable test ‍against Texas is also a realistic outcome.
* ‌ SRS Distribution Las Vegas Bowl: Iowa and Utah are potential contenders, promising a ⁢physical contest.Nebraska⁢ and Utah could also provide a similar matchup.

January⁣ 2nd: Continuing the Momentum

The new year ‌begins with more compelling bowl games, building towards the College Football ‍Playoff.

* Lockheed Martin ‌Armed Forces bowl: Kansas State and Navy ‌are strong candidates, honoring our ​nation’s service members. Arizona and Army⁢ are also⁢ possibilities, ​offering a similar patriotic theme.
* ⁣ AutoZone Liberty Bowl: Iowa State and Kentucky are frequently ⁣discussed as potential participants. Kansas State and Kentucky could also deliver a competitive matchup.
* Duke’s Mayo Bowl: Louisville and Tennessee are a potential pairing,promising a high-scoring affair. Duke and Missouri could‌ also provide an exciting contest.
* Holiday Bowl: SMU and Washington ‍are often mentioned, offering a matchup of rising programs. SMU and Arizona State is another⁣ possibility,⁢ bringing⁢ a different dynamic to the game.
